Before we dive into the best spots for Italian food Flagstaff boasts, let’s clarify what we mean by “Italian food.” The culinary landscape of Italy is incredibly diverse, with each region boasting its own distinct specialties and ingredients. From the creamy risotto of Northern Italy to the spicy pasta dishes of the South, the flavors are as varied as the landscapes.

When considering Italian food, it’s essential to distinguish between authentic dishes and those that have been adapted (sometimes heavily) for American palates. While there’s nothing inherently wrong with “Americanized Italian” (think spaghetti and meatballs), this guide focuses on establishments that strive for authenticity, using fresh, high-quality ingredients and time-honored cooking techniques. We’ll be looking for places that offer a true taste of Italy, from the perfectly al dente pasta to the rich and flavorful sauces.

Restaurant Spotlight: Fratelli Pizza

Located in the heart of downtown Flagstaff, Fratelli Pizza offers a taste of Naples in the Arizona mountains. This bustling pizzeria is known for its authentic Neapolitan-style pizza, cooked to perfection in a wood-fired oven. The atmosphere is lively and inviting, making it a popular spot for locals and tourists alike.

The menu features a variety of classic and creative pizzas, all made with fresh, high-quality ingredients. The Margherita, with its simple yet flavorful combination of San Marzano tomatoes, fresh mozzarella, and basil, is a must-try. For something a bit more adventurous, try the Diavola, topped with spicy salami and chili flakes. They also offer a selection of appetizers, salads, and desserts. The tiramisu is a perfect ending to any meal.

What makes Fratelli Pizza stand out is its commitment to authenticity and its use of traditional Neapolitan techniques. The dough is made fresh daily and allowed to rise slowly, resulting in a light and airy crust. The wood-fired oven imparts a smoky flavor that elevates the pizza to another level. As local, Mark Johnson stated, “The pizza here is the closest thing to real Italian pizza I’ve had outside of Italy. You can’t go wrong!”
